Transaction 614ec3cd64ddb7037cd6e40755823c2f71a94cadc6ce1a24997ac346e261b0b8
1 Input
1 Output
-
614ec3cd64ddb7037cd6e40755823c2f71a94cadc6ce1a24997ac346e261b0b8:0
- value
- 18862451
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81025ede5d06b8dc49e18afe0d5ae3b653824fa1 OP_EQUAL
- address
- 3DT9vzzbvGrL3PhmJDXgqi2dyJ6t5vc7ZZ